Lady Gaga is paying a special visit to New York City's Stonewall Inn, helping mark 50 years since the uprising the catalyzed the modern LGBTQ rights movement in a way that only the versatile and colorful global superstar can. Gaga dropped by the legendary tavern Friday afternoon -- exactly five decades to the day of the infamous NYPD raid that ignited tensions and fiery protests in city streets for days and ultimately spurred the birth of the movement for gay rights both in the United States and around the world. "It makes me cry. I am so emotional today," a visibly teary Gaga, wearing jean shorts, a rainbow jacket and glistening red thigh-high boots, told the crowd. "This community has fought and continued to fight a war of acceptance, a war of tolerance -- and the most relentless bravery. You are the definition of courage, do you know that? This is a celebration of all of you in every single way."
